Output 1821f61d0adefcee574418294b0608849c23482ee4a7d43dd8de17dedd41a000:1

value
511061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a88150018187ede6f1b7799d990c601f0f49136a OP_EQUAL
address
3H3zMZbmJcigdxEtsDJ1j5kTCocXDZKJQD
transaction
1821f61d0adefcee574418294b0608849c23482ee4a7d43dd8de17dedd41a000
spent
true